Precious Moments

The other day when I came home from work I asked one of my daughters if they had checked the mail.

“Yes.” She replied.

I then asked her where it was and she gave me an odd inquisitive look and then said, “Wait. What did you say?”

“The mail,” I said, reminding her.

“What about it?”

“Did. You. Check. The. Mail?”

“Uh, no.” she said.

“So when I asked you the first time if you checked the mail you told me yes because…why?”

Another odd inquisitive look crossed over her face and she furled her brow and looked me straight in the eye and said, “What?”
